We needed a campsite, so we drove to Falkland and headed up into the hills, following the logging road, and soon found Woods Lake and grabbed the first empty campsite.  As this was a long weekend we felt lucky to find anything.  The lake had loons, ducks, flowers, and other campers.  It seemed strange to have neighbours after three nights on our own.

Sunday July 1st
The lake is in the middle of a maze of logging tracks and all we had to do was drive out to the south and join the main road.  We were aiming for the Salmon Lake Road.  We actually came out on Salmon River Road but didn’t notice the difference until we were thoroughly confused.  However, during our wandering we saw much beautiful country, some of it from each direction, and met many cows, and a few deer, before we came out to the Douglas Lake Ranch and the town of Merrit.
